Kawasaki Vulcan 1700 Vaquero Weight (836lb)

Quick answer

Across 6 covered model years from 2011 to 2022, the Kawasaki Vulcan 1700 Vaquero motorcycle has supplied wet/running weights ranging from 835.8 lb (379.1 kg) to 895.3 lb (406.1 kg).

Wet / running weight835.8 lb (379.1 kg) to 895.3 lb (406.1 kg)
Fuel capacity5.3 US gal (20.06 L)
Full tank fuel weight32.9 lb (14.9 kg)

Kawasaki Vulcan 1700 Vaquero weight & related specs

Model years covered 2011, 2012, 2013, 2014, 2021, 2022
Wet / running weight 835.8 lb (379.1 kg) to 895.3 lb (406.1 kg)
Engine displacement 1,700 cc
Torque 107.6 lb-ft (145.9 Nm) to 108.1 lb-ft (146.5 Nm)
Fuel capacity 5.3 US gal (20.06 L)
Full-tank fuel weight (estimated) 32.9 lb (14.9 kg)

What the weight numbers tell you

Using a model-level wet weight comparison, the Kawasaki Vulcan 1700 Vaquero is heavier than about 63.5% of 26 Kawasaki touring motorcycles with compatible weight data.
The listed fuel tank capacity is 5.3 US gal (20.06 L). A full tank of gasoline is estimated to weigh about 32.9 lb (14.9 kg); this fuel mass is already part of a wet/running weight figure.
The supplied data shows model-year weight differences, so the safest figure is the one attached to your exact year rather than a single all-years number.
